Why Hawaii trips get complicated faster than people expect
Hawaii tends to produce false confidence because it is domestic for many U.S. Travelers, especially those leaving California. No passport, no currency conversion, familiar hotel brands, familiar airline companies. That familiarity conceals the preparation traps.
The first trap is presuming all islands deliver the same experience. They do not. Oahu can deal with travelers who want city energy, surf culture, night life, historical sites, and broad dining options. Maui attracts numerous honeymooners and couples who desire refined resorts and picturesque drives. The Big Island rewards tourists who appreciate geology, black lava fields, long driving days, and a more spread-out rhythm. Kauai attract people going after significant landscapes and a quieter tone. If a traveler books the incorrect island for their personality, no pool upgrade will repair it.
The second trap is flight timing. A lower fare can look wise until it lands so late that the opening night develops into a recovery session rather of a trip. Households with kids feel this specifically difficult. A red-eye home might conserve money and cost the next two days. West Coast departures, airport transfers, check-in windows, and the body clock all matter. Tourists from San Jose typically ignore just how much smoother the journey feels when the schedule is built around energy, not simply price.
Another concern is resort sprawl. Some homes are gorgeous however separated. Others sit in walkable zones where supper, beach time, and a last-minute snorkel rental are simple. A Travel Representative who prepares individualized travel learns really quickly that the "finest" hotel on paper is frequently the incorrect one for a specific tourist. The goal is fit, not applause.

The genuine worth is not simply booking, it is editing
Most travelers do not need more choices. They need less, better options.
That editing function is among the least glamorous and most important parts of travel preparation. A Hawaii itinerary can quickly collapse under a lot of attractive ideas. Dawn walking. Helicopter tour. Snorkel cruise. Luau. Surf lesson. Scenic drive. Great dining. Whale seeing in season. Spa afternoon. Farmers market. Waterfall path. Two islands in 7 days because someone online stated you "must" island-hop.
Someone requires to say no.
A sharp advisor modifies based upon friction, not fantasy. How many mornings can this group realistically handle? Are they beach individuals who claim they want experience, or adventure people who need downtime? Is the 2nd island worth the packaging, checkout, transit, and reset? Will a lower space rate be forgotten after the first long walk to the beach with drowsy children and excessive gear?
Online travel platforms seldom secure people from their own optimism. A human planner often does.

Another circumstance, household travel and the hidden expenses of "saving cash"
A family of five from San Jose wishes to do one of their very first significant beach trips together. The moms and dads have a firm budget plan and assume the winning strategy is easy: book the most affordable airfare, find a big space, then include activities later.
On paper, this looks responsible. In practice, it can backfire in four different directions. The cheapest flights might include punishing times for kids. The "large space" might still feel cramped for 5 individuals after day two. Waiting on activities can leave the very best family-friendly timing unavailable. A property that seemed economical may charge enough in food, parking, or transportation to eliminate the initial savings.
A Travel Representative does not amazingly make every line product cheaper. The better outcome comes from stabilizing the entire invest. In some cases the wise relocation is paying more for flights and less for hotel luxury. Often it is the opposite. Sometimes it indicates choosing a home where breakfast gain access to and beach distance decrease the day-to-day friction that causes spending too much elsewhere.
Here is a short way to think about Hawaii value:
- Spend where the trip gains hours, not simply status.
- Protect sleep on both ends of the itinerary.
- Be suspicious of "cheap" choices that include transfers or long drives.
- Match the island to the family's real pace.
- Leave room for weather condition, state of mind, and spontaneous fun.
That is not generic advice. In Hawaii, where every day brings a high emotional and monetary worth, losing half a day to a poor planning call harms more than on a city trip where you can pivot easily.

What makes island preparation various from Journeys to Germany
The keyword Trips to Germany may sound far from Hawaii, but the comparison works. Germany generally rewards mobility. Tourists can move city to city, construct around rail schedules, and stack culture, history, and neighborhoods in close series. If one museum is crowded or one dinner disappoints, the journey has a lot of alternate texture nearby.
Trips to Hawaii work differently. Island travel magnifies each option. Resort area, beach conditions, car logistics, flight timing, and activity pacing matter more due to the fact that the environment is less forgiving. You can not delicately hop across landscapes in the exact same way. A poor lodging decision in Hawaii tends to affect every single day. A poor hotel choice in Munich might only affect the nights.
